using System;
using System.Text.RegularExpressions;
public class Example
{
public static void Main()
{
string pattern = @"^\d*$|^(?:\d{1,3}(?:\.\d{3})*(?:,\d{1,5})?)$|^(?:\d{1,3}(?:,\d{3})*(?:\.\d{1,5})?)$|^(?:\d{1,3}(?: \d{3})*(?:[,.]\d{1,5})?)$";
string input = @"123
1.234.567
12.345.678
123.456.789
1.234.567,89
1.234,56789
1,2
0,123
1,234,567
12,345,678
123,456,789
1,234,567.89
1,234.56789
1.2
0.123
1 234 567
12 345 678
123 456 789
1 234 567,89
1 234 567.89
1 234,56789
1 234.56789";
RegexOptions options = RegexOptions.Multiline | RegexOptions.IgnoreCase;
foreach (Match m in Regex.Matches(input, pattern, options))
{
Console.WriteLine("'{0}' found at index {1}.", m.Value, m.Index);
}
}
}
